User Handbook for Military Land Rover Series III Long Wheel Base) with a 109 in. wheelbase, Truck, Utility, 3/4 ton, 4X4, vehicles with 12 & 24 volt electrical equipment. With 208 pages, very well illustrated. Issued 1982, Part no. 608179, Code no. 22230.
